Djuki Mala takes their international smash hit production to Fringe 2019.
Winners of Adelaide Fringe's Best Dance 2017 indigenous dance sensations took the world by storm with their unique, infectious and high-energy productions.... like a confetti cannon point blank to the heart.
Djuki Mala wow audiences with a spectacular fusion of traditional dance, pop-culture and storytelling that is a marvel of timing, comedy and clowning with a hefty dose of heart and soul!
Finding overnight success from their 'Zorba the Greek' dance, which saw a whopping 500,000 hits on YouTube thanks to Frank Djirrimbilpilwuy, the group is ready for another spectacular string of shows.
